OTC Multi day breakout. Chased a little on my entry. Was trying to get in at 0.70 but thought it was about to run so I just bought the ask. Could have waited a half hour or so and got my fill on the bid. Volume died off the next day and it basically went sideways for three days. Got a small fill on a sell at 0.80. Sold the rest as it started to break down. Was risking $1100 when entering the trade so I’m okay with the size of the loss.

Looking to have its first up day at 9:45am. My mistake was I bought on light volume - Under 50,000 shares and I bought at the top as it appeared to be breaking out. I've bought a few tops lately on OTC as they usually break out - but not lately. Should have waited until the end of day for a potential #5 and bought off a dip. Sloppy trading lately. I did not trade my specific niche pattern and didn't wait until 3:30pm or afterwards. Common theme over string of losses.
